In Superman’s 'hometown,' a pastor vows to fight Satan’s influence at the local library
METROPOLIS, Ill. — The pastor began his sermon with a warning. Satan was winning territory across America, and now he was coming for their small town on the banks of the Ohio River in southern Illinois. “Evil is moving and motivated,” Brian Anderson told his congregation at Eastland Life...
Foundation receives $1 million for community center, preserves Lincoln High history
PADUCAH — The Lincoln High School Historical Foundation (LHSHF) will receive $1 million in state funding to boost its future project, a community center on Paducah’s Southside. The Lincoln Station will be built on the same lot where Lincoln High School was located, on the corner of South...
Paducah police warn of scam with ‘spoofed’ number
PADUCAH, Ky. (KBSI) – Paducah police warn residents of a scammer posing as a police officer. Police say Tuesday, April 16, someone in Paducah was contacted by a scammer posing as a Paducah police officer. Police say the person “spoofed” his/her phone number to show up as the Paducah...
